Kolkata is one of India's safest cities for solo women — the street culture is genuinely different.
The Metro is clean, safe, and has women-only coaches; yellow taxis are metered and reliable.
Park Street is the nightlife and café spine; Ballygunge and Lake Road are the best residential bases.
Howrah Bridge at dawn (6–7am) is one of the most photogenic 20 minutes in India — and there are almost no touts.
Budget ₹3–4 days: Kumartuli potters' quarter and New Market are completely off most tourist itineraries.

Fake porter overcharge at Howrah
highWhere: Kolkata
What happens: Real porters wear red shirt + metal armband with number. Pre-fix price: ₹50–₹100/bag.

Auto/Taxi Meter Refusal & Inflation
highWhere: All 12 cities (worst: Delhi, Kolkata, Chennai, Varanasi)
What happens: Driver says meter is 'broken', quotes flat fare 3–10x normal. In Mumbai it's rarer because of strict meter culture. In Bangalore mostly auto drivers at airport/railway.
How to avoid: Default to Uber/Ola/Rapido — they're cheap and GPS-tracked. If using auto, agree fare upfront after checking Uber price. In Mumbai insist on meter (it's the law).
Train Ticket / IRCTC Scam
highWhere: Delhi, Mumbai, Kolkata, Chennai, Varanasi
What happens: Near railway stations, agents sell 'confirmed tickets' that are fake or for slow local trains sold as fast express. Variant: tout claims 'your train is cancelled' and herds you to a fake ticket counter to sell flights/tours at 5x rates.
How to avoid: Book ONLY via irctc.co.in, IRCTC Rail Connect app, MakeMyTrip, or RedBus. Verify train status on the official IRCTC app. Ignore anyone outside the station offering ticket help.
